Sample size = n = 716

p = Proportion of residents having red hair = 16.98% = 0.1698

Since, n* p > 10 and n*(1-p) > 10, we can assume the sampling distribution of proportion to be approximately normal with

Mean = p = 0.1698

Standard deviation = \sqrt{\frac{p*(1-p)}{n}}=\sqrt{\frac{0.1698*(1-0.1698)}{716}}=0.014

So,

​​​​P(p > 0.15829) =P(z > \frac{0.15829-0.1698}{0.014})

Converting normal variate p into standard normal variate z,

  =P(z > -0.82)

It can be obtained using the z table by finding the area corresponding to the z = -0.8 at 0.02 probability.

= 0.2061

Hence, option (b) is the correct option.
